See all topics Shortly after being sworn in as head of the Environmental Protection Agency, Lee Zeldin accused the previous administration of stashing $20 billion worth of “gold bars” in a Citibank account and vowed to claw the money back to the Treasury. The new environment chief has frequently touted a theory, spurred by a video from right-wing activist group Project Veritas, that the Biden administration unlawfully awarded $20 billion to progressive ventures. In that video, a Biden-era EPA employee compared the rush to get Congress’s climate law funding out the door before Trump took office to tossing gold bars off the Titanic. “It’s a clear-cut case of waste and abuse,” Zeldin told Fox News in February. “The entire scheme, in my opinion, is criminal. We found the gold bars; we want them back.” In reality, the “gold bars” are congressionally appropriated funds from a 2022 climate law, meant to be distributed to small, nonprofit lenders that focus on energy efficiency and clean energ...
